quorum or quorum common male name. It is forensic or legal term that comes from the latin and remains as cultismo without evolution. We must point out, however, that it is the abbreviation of a longer expression: quorum [praesentia sufficit] (' whose [presence is sufficient]'), hence its meaning refers to the number of people, individuals, participants or participants that are requ ieren begins or approved measures or fundamental decisions in a Parliament, Assembly, meeting of neighbours and other legal character. Therefore in expressions as "having or not quorum" refer to that particular number of attendees for a law, agreement or any other matter is approved or not.
